Smoked Salmon Sandwich
Try our favorite smoked salmon sandwich! Bursting with flavors, it's a mouthwatering delight fit for brunch, a light lunch, or dinner.
Prep Time10 minutes mins
Total Time10 minutes mins
Course: Appetizer
Cuisine: Danish
Servings: 2 sandwiches
Calories: 352kcal
- ⅓ cup cream cheese 75 g, Note 1
- 1 heaped tablespoon Greek yogurt
- a pinch of chili flakes or cayenne pepper, to taste
- small handful of arugula
- 2 slices sourdough bread Note 2
- 2.5 oz smoked salmon 75 g, Note 3
- 1 tablespoon capers
- a squeeze of fresh lemon juice
- 1 tablespoon chives chopped
- fine sea salt and freshly ground black pepper
- Regular cream cheese (Philadelphia style) or reduced-fat cream cheese. However, ensure the cheese has at least 16 % fat.
- Bread: Alternatively, use other sturdy bread like whole grain, multigrain, pumpernickel, or rye. A crusty French baguette is also great.
- Salmon: About 4-6 slices of smoked salmon, depending on size.
